34 CHAPTER 3: CONFIGURING MAIL SECURITY
Attachment Control Attachment filtering can be used to control a wide range of problems
originating from the use of attachments, including the following:
Viruses — Attachments that can potentially contain viruses can be
blocked.
Offensive Content — The 3Com Email Firewall can block the transfer
of images which reduces the possibility that an offensive picture will
be transmitted to or from your company mail system.
Confidentiality — Prevents unauthorized documents from being
transmitted through the 3Com Email Firewall.
Productivity — Prevents your systems from being abused by
employees.
Select Mail Delivery -> Attachment Control from the menu to configure
your attachment types and actions.
Default action — Set the default attachment control action for items
not specifically listed in the
Attachment Types
list. The default is
“Pass” which allows all attachments. Any file types defined in the
Attachment Types
list will override the default setting.
Enable Attachment Control — Select the check box to enable
Attachment Control for inbound and/or outbound mail.
Attachment Types — Click Edit to configure the attachment types.
Action — Select an action to be performed. Options include:
Just log: Log the event and take no further action.
Reject mail: The message is rejected with notification to the
sending system.
Quarantine mail: The message is placed into quarantine.
Discard mail: The message is discarded without notification to the
sending system.
